If you have moved some pages in the new folder, called site1, the links from (f.e.) http://www.yoursite.com/yourpage.html should be changed inOriginally Posted by jabie5
http://www.yoursite.com/site1/yourpage.html . The links to your index page should remain http://www.yoursite.com/index.html
